Just for grins, while bike is on centerstand prior to installing the brace, grab one bar end and jerk back and forth watching how the wheel/fender don't follow the shake pattern.......then do the same with brace on. This ties the fork tube cyl. together acting as one since there was previously no support between the axle mount and the lower tripple clamp. Also will reduce front tire cupping as long as there is no underinflation issue.
